#7b446d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b446d is composed of 48.2% red, 26.7%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 11.4%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 315.3 degrees, a saturation of 28.8% and a lightness of 37.5%. #7b446d color hex could be obtained by blending #f688da with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#7b446d color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.
#7b446d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b446d has RGB values of R:123, G:68,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.11,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8078445.
